Product Description
PE pipe fittings, short for Polyethylene pipe fittings, are essential components in modern piping systems. These fittings are primarily made from high - density polyethylene (HDPE) or low - density polyethylene (LDPE).
They come in a wide variety of types, including elbows for changing pipe direction, tees for branching, couplings for connecting pipes, and reducers for size transitions. One of their key advantages is excellent corrosion resistance, making them suitable for various applications such as water supply, gas transportation, and drainage systems. PE pipe fittings are known for their easy installation, with connection methods like hot - melt and electro - fusion ensuring a strong and leak - proof bond. They are also lightweight, durable, and have good flexibility, allowing them to adapt to different terrains and temperature changes. All in all, PE pipe fittings play a crucial role in ensuring the efficient and reliable operation of piping networks.

A PE hot - melt tee is a crucial fitting in polyethylene (PE) piping systems. It is designed to split or combine the flow of fluids or gases within the pipeline network.
Made from high - density polyethylene, this type of tee offers outstanding chemical resistance. It can handle a wide variety of substances without being affected by chemical reactions, ensuring the integrity of the transported media. The material also provides excellent durability, with high impact strength and the ability to resist environmental stress cracking. This makes it suitable for long - term use in various outdoor and indoor applications.
The "hot - melt" in its name refers to the installation method. During installation, the ends of the pipes and the fittings are heated to a specific temperature. This softens the PE material, allowing the pipes to be joined firmly with the tee. The hot - melt connection forms a monolithic joint, which is highly reliable and leak - proof, significantly enhancing the safety and efficiency of the piping system.
PE hot - melt tees come in different sizes and configurations to meet the diverse requirements of different projects. They are extensively used in water supply systems, both for domestic and industrial applications, as well as in sewage and drainage systems, and in some cases, in gas distribution pipelines. Their versatility, combined with the ease of installation and the advantages of the PE material, make them a popular choice in modern piping infrastructure.
A PE hot - melt elbow is a vital fitting in polyethylene (PE) piping systems. Made from high - quality PE resin, it is designed to change the direction of a pipeline, typically at a 90 - degree or 45 - degree angle.
The "hot - melt" in its name refers to its connection method. During installation, both the ends of the elbow and the corresponding PE pipes are heated to a specific temperature. This heating softens the PE material, enabling them to be fused together. Once cooled, a strong, leak - proof bond is formed. This connection method ensures the integrity and durability of the piping system.
PE hot - melt elbows are highly resistant to corrosion, chemicals, and environmental factors. They are lightweight yet robust, which simplifies the installation process and reduces labor costs. Their wide application ranges from water supply networks, both in domestic and industrial settings, to irrigation systems, where they contribute to the smooth and efficient flow of fluids.
A PE flange root, also known as a polyethylene flange adapter, is a vital component in PE piping systems. It serves as a connection point between PE pipes and other equipment or components with flange - type connections.
Constructed from high - density polyethylene (HDPE), the PE flange root inherits all the beneficial properties of PE materials. HDPE offers excellent chemical resistance, enabling it to withstand exposure to a wide range of chemicals without degradation. This makes the PE flange root suitable for use in various industrial applications involving the transportation of corrosive substances. Additionally, it has high impact resistance, ensuring durability even in harsh operating conditions.
The design of the PE flange root allows for easy connection to standard flanges. It is typically installed through a hot - melt or electro - fusion process, which creates a strong, leak - proof bond with the PE pipe. Once installed, the flange root provides a stable and reliable interface that can withstand high pressures and maintain the integrity of the pipeline system.
These flange roots are widely used in industries such as water treatment plants, chemical processing facilities, and oil and gas distribution networks. They play a crucial role in ensuring the seamless integration of PE piping with pumps, valves, tanks, and other equipment, contributing to the overall efficiency and safety of the fluid - handling systems.
A PE hot - melt cross, also called a polyethylene hot - melt four - way fitting, is a key component in PE piping systems.
1. Material and Properties
- It is made of polyethylene (PE), usually high - density polyethylene (HDPE). PE is a thermoplastic polymer renowned for its excellent chemical resistance. This means the PE hot - melt cross can be used to transport a wide range of fluids, from water to various industrial chemicals, without being corroded or damaged by chemical reactions. It also has high impact strength, which allows it to endure external forces and vibrations during the operation of the piping system. Additionally, PE is lightweight, making the installation process easier compared to some metal fittings.
2. Function and Application
- Its main function is to enable the connection of four pipes at a single point. This allows for the division, combination, or redirection of fluid flow within the piping network. In water supply systems, for example, a PE hot - melt cross can be used to distribute water from a main pipeline to multiple branch lines, serving different areas or facilities. In industrial settings, it can be applied in chemical processing plants to manage the complex flow of different chemical substances in the production process.
3. Installation Method
- The "hot - melt" in its name indicates its installation method. During installation, the ends of the pipes and the fitting are heated to a specific temperature using a hot - melt welding machine. As the PE material softens, the pipes can be inserted into the corresponding sockets of the cross fitting. Once cooled, a strong, monolithic bond is formed, creating a leak - proof connection. This installation method ensures the integrity and reliability of the piping system, reducing the risk of leaks and ensuring smooth fluid transportation.
In summary, the PE hot - melt cross is an essential and versatile fitting in modern PE piping systems, contributing to the efficient and safe operation of fluid - handling networks in various industries.
A PE hot - melt threaded part is a specialized component within polyethylene (PE) piping systems, combining the advantages of PE materials with the functionality of threaded connections.
1. Material Basics
- Constructed from polyethylene, typically high - density polyethylene (HDPE), it benefits from the material's remarkable characteristics. HDPE offers excellent chemical resistance, making it suitable for transporting a wide range of fluids, including corrosive chemicals, without degradation. It also has high impact resistance, ensuring durability in various operating conditions, from industrial plants to outdoor water supply systems. Additionally, PE is lightweight, which simplifies handling and installation processes compared to metal counterparts.
2. Function and Design
- The key feature of a PE hot - melt threaded part is its threaded section. This allows for easy connection to other threaded components such as valves, meters, or other pipes with threaded ends. The threading provides a secure and tight fit, which helps prevent leaks and ensures the smooth flow of fluids within the piping system. The hot - melt aspect comes into play during installation. The non - threaded part of the PE component can be connected to standard PE pipes through a hot - melt process. By heating both the pipe end and the fitting socket to a specific temperature, the PE material softens, enabling a strong, seamless bond when they are joined and then cooled.
3. Applications
- These parts are widely used in a variety of industries. In the plumbing industry, they are often used in residential and commercial water supply systems, allowing for the connection of fixtures like faucets or water meters to the main PE pipelines. In industrial settings, such as chemical processing plants, they can be used to connect equipment like pumps or storage tanks to the PE piping network, facilitating the transfer of chemicals or other process fluids. Their ability to combine the ease of PE pipe installation with the convenience of threaded connections makes them a practical choice for many piping applications.
In summary, PE hot - melt threaded parts are important components that bridge the gap between traditional threaded connections and modern PE piping technology, offering reliability, versatility, and ease of installation in fluid - handling systems.
